- The distance between Cairo, Egypt and Paulo Afonso, Brazil is approximately 8,626 km or 5,360 mi.
- To reach Cairo in this distance one would set out from Paulo Afonso bearing 56.1°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Cairo bearing 71.3° or ENE .
- Cairo has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Paulo Afonso has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- Cairo is in or near the subtropical desert biome whereas Paulo Afonso is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The average temperature is 4.2 °C (7.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.3 °C (16.7°F) more in Cairo.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 556.8 mm (21.9 in) less which is equivalent to 556.8 l/m² (13.67 US gal/ft²) or 5,568,000 l/ha (595,256 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.2° lower in Cairo than in Paulo Afonso.
- Relative humidity levels are 11.7%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 7°C (12.6°F) lower.
